Diet is one of the most crucial factors to ensure a parrot’s health. A parrot should be fed a high-quality pellet or crumble diet that is designed to meet the requirements of the birds. It should be supplemented by fresh fruits vegetables, as well as a few grains. Diet should be controlled to avoid overweight, which can lead to serious health problems for pet parrots.

In the wild, African grays are omnivorous and will eat fruit and vegetables as well as nuts. However, in captivity, seeds shouldn't be the primary source of food as they can be low in vitamins and minerals. Pellets are a better choice, since they are a good source of the essential nutrients. It is also crucial that the parrot has fresh water available.

One of the most frequent issues with African Greys is their tendency to chew and destroy anything in their enclosures. You can limit this by ensuring that their cages are big enough and with various materials for toys. Egg cartons can be transformed into a foraging toy by putting treats inside them and wrapping them in paper or cardboard. You can also make puzzle toys that distribute food by using paper cups and skewers. You can also enrich your pet's space by putting in non-toxic plants and hammocks.
